    Borough Market is a food lover's paradise with an incredible variety of vendors. You'll find…read moreeverything from cooked and fresh seafood, fresh fruit, juices and smoothies, artisan cheeses, sauces, and cuisines from all over the world, including Chinese, Thai, Italian, Indian, Korean, American, and so much more. With so many tempting options, it's honestly hard to decide what to eat. One thing I really appreciated was that many vendors offered samples, so you could try before you buy. During our visit, we sampled the famous chocolate covered strawberries, paella, and wild mushroom risotto. I also bought the Black Pig Honey Truffle Parm sandwich. The chocolate covered strawberries were exactly what you'd expect, fresh strawberries coated in chocolate. If you enjoy that classic combination, you'll probably love them, but they weren't anything particularly special to me. The paella had great flavor, but the rice was a little undercooked for my taste, so I wasn't a fan of the texture. The wild mushroom risotto was the standout. It was rich, creamy, packed with earthy mushroom flavor, and had an excellent texture. It was easily one of my favorite bites of the day. I also tried the Black Pig Honey Truffle Parm sandwich. The bread was fantastic, crispy on the outside and soft and fluffy on the inside, and the fennel apple slaw added a refreshing crunch. Unfortunately, the pulled pork was very dry. I think it would have been much better if the pork had been kept warm in its own juices instead of continuing to cook on the griddle. That would have kept it moist and tender. As it was... the pulled pork was dry as hell. :) One thing every vendor had in common was friendly and welcoming customer service. Despite how busy and crowded the market gets, the atmosphere is lively, energetic, and full of people enjoying great food. It's definitely a must-visit for anyone who loves trying a variety of foods in one place.

    Islington Farmer's Market takes place in the playground of the William Tyndale School every Sunday…read morebetween 10am and 2pm. As one might expect from a market that takes place in a school playground it is pretty small affair. It is exclusively a food market. There are around 12 stalls selling meat, cheese, fish, vegetables and juices. In contrast to other markets there is little food to eat as you walk (pies etc.) so best to visit for staples if you live in the area. There are a good selection of quality items; the juices are particularly good. This farmer's market isn't spectacular but nonetheless sells good stuff and worth visiting if you're a local.
